P&G has been standing with and supporting the Red Cross & Crescent Societies in more than 20 countries across Europe. These impactful grassroot efforts showcase the breadth of possibilities we have at P&G to be a force for good in our world.

In Italy, P&G and the Italian Red Cross launched “Aula 162”, a program dedicated to work inclusion for people who may have been made redundant due to covid-19, women who are victims of violence, migrants and refugees in need of assistance as they arrive in a new country. Further to this, they are initiating a telemedicine program to help vulnerable people be monitored at home, thereby reducing the pressure in hospitals.

In the UK, we are proud about the sustained support to the British Red Cross announced last week! The funding will enable the delivery of critical initiatives, including providing practical and emotional support to people in need through their coronavirus support line, helping people resettle safely back into their homes after a hospital visit, supporting the national vaccination programme, providing access to wheelchairs and other mobility aids as well as food and medicine deliveries.

Since the early days of the pandemic, we have worked with the Turkish Red Crescent to provide millions of everyday essentials to those who needed them most. We stepped up during the Izmir earthquake to quickly respond to the emergency needs with P&G products, hygiene kits and clothes. What’s more, we have donated 400 Turkish Lira ($50) worth grocery vouchers to thousands of families struggling economically.

With the Ukrainian Red Cross, we teamed up to support the medical staff, providing personal protective equipment kits in healthcare facilities with shortage of such equipment.

In Greece, P&G joined forces with the Hellenic Red Cross to shape a yearly program in support of the homeless. A mobile unit with trained medical personnel, social workers & volunteers are offering ongoing support to homeless people in the form of food and product necessities, medical treatment, hygiene kits, blankets and clothes. All meant to protect them against the effects of COVID-19.
